How Turnitin’s AI Detection Works

Turnitin scans your text for patterns that match AI writing styles. The system looks at word choices, sentence structure, and flow to spot content made by tools like ChatGPT or Ryne AI.

Analysis of Writing Patterns

Turnitin’s AI detection system looks closely at how text flows. The software spots patterns that humans don’t usually make when writing. AI writing often shows repetitive sentence structures and predictable word choices that form a digital fingerprint.

These patterns stand out because they lack the natural ups and downs of human writing. The system flags content with too many similar phrases or sentences that follow the same rhythm throughout a document.

The telltale signs of AI writing hide in plain sight, waiting for the right tools to spot them.

Text created by machines tends to miss the random quirks that make human writing special. Turnitin scans for these missing elements, like unusual word pairings or creative language jumps.

The AI detector also checks how ideas connect, looking for the smooth but sometimes imperfect transitions that real people create. This pattern analysis works alongside other tools to catch content from Ryne AI and similar services that try to bypass detection.

Identifying Semantic Similarities

Turnitin digs deep into how words connect in your paper. The system spots patterns in your writing by checking how ideas flow together, not just matching exact words. After the 2023 updates, Turnitin added stronger NLP tools that catch even cleverly reworded text.

This makes it harder for AI text to slip through unnoticed.

The detection process works like a smart reader who notices your writing style. It compares the meaning behind sentences rather than just looking for copied phrases. Ryne AI users should know that Turnitin can spot similar thinking patterns across different papers.

The algorithms have gotten good at finding content that keeps the same core ideas but uses different words to express them.
